How to keep NOW () and TODAY () From updating.

WebMar 19, 2016 · Windows. Mar 19, 2016. #3. The NOW and TODAY functions will update each time the sheet they are on calculates. If you want the cells that contain those functions to have static time/date stamps you will need to use VBA in conjunction with whatever event you want the time/date stamp to capture. 0.
